Incremental rebuilds on Fernpress regenerate only pages whose content hash changed; full rebuilds run nightly. Security reviewers should note the build worker has read-only access to the content store and cannot touch the publishing keys. If the worker's sealed config must be reopened during review, unseal it with the recovery passphrase below.

vault phrase of tajef-tafog = istox-sorax-zorox-casok-holox-kelix-weneth-drueth-casion

## Environment Variables for SproutCycle Plugins

Hey plugin folks! SproutCycle, the plant-watering scheduler from Fernloft Labs, reads everything from a single env file, so your plugin should too. The basics: SPROUT_TZ controls schedule timezones, WATER_WINDOW_MIN sets the earliest watering hour, and PLUGIN_SANDBOX=strict keeps your code from touching the pump drivers directly. Most plugins also talk to the Fernloft sync API, which needs credentials. Right after the sandbox line in your env file, add the line that sets your sync secret.

sealed setting: RELAY_SECRET3=3af

Quick note for release cuts: the Dovetail kiosk watchdog (Wrenlock) will lock the service account if the new build fails its heartbeat three times post-deploy. Before you push, make sure you can unlock it — boot the kiosk into Wrenlock's recovery console and choose "Restore Account." When it asks for the passphrase, enter the one listed just below here.

strongbox words: zordor-quenax

Internal Memo — Regional Sales Review

To the Board: the semi-annual review of Tarnwell Goods' southern region is complete. Sales rose 4% overall, led by the Ashvale district; the Corrin Flats territory declined for a third consecutive period. Management attributes the gap to distributor turnover rather than demand. Corrective staffing actions begin next month. The implications for our forward plans are summarised in the confidential note below.

board note of kageg-bahof: The renewal with Holwynax Holdings closes at $2 million a year, 5 percent below the last contract. Project Ulaath slips by two quarters because of the supplier delay.